Risks Associated with Downloading from Zona Lagu and Similar Sites

Alright, let's talk about the risks, shall we? Downloading from sites like Zona Lagu isn't always smooth sailing. There are potential dangers lurking, and it's super important to be aware of them. One of the biggest risks is the presence of malware. Websites offering free downloads can be a breeding ground for viruses, Trojans, and other malicious software that can infect your devices. These programs can steal your personal information, damage your files, or even take control of your computer. Another significant risk is the legal aspect. Downloading copyrighted music without permission is illegal in many countries and can lead to serious consequences, including fines or even legal action. Moreover, the quality of the downloaded files can be inconsistent. The audio quality might be poor, resulting in a less-than-enjoyable listening experience. You might encounter songs that are mislabeled or incomplete. There are also ethical considerations to keep in mind. Downloading music illegally deprives artists and music creators of their rightful income. This practice can discourage them from creating new music and ultimately impact the entire music ecosystem. This is why it's crucial to be cautious when downloading from any website that offers free music, including Zona Lagu. Always scan files with antivirus software before opening them, and make sure your operating system and security software are updated to protect you from potential threats. Legal Considerations: Is Downloading Music from Zona Lagu Legal?

Now, let's address the elephant in the room: the legality of downloading music from Zona Lagu. The answer isn't always straightforward; it largely depends on the specific circumstances and the laws of your country. As a general rule, downloading copyrighted music without permission from the copyright holder is illegal. This means that if a website like Zona Lagu does not have the proper licensing agreements with the artists or record labels, the downloads are likely illegal. This violates the copyright holder's exclusive rights, including the right to reproduce and distribute their work. Legal consequences for downloading copyrighted music can vary widely. You could face warnings, fines, or even lawsuits, depending on the severity of the infringement and the jurisdiction. The responsibility often falls on the downloader to ensure they have the proper licenses or permissions. It's your job to make sure the music you're downloading is obtained legally. This includes paying for music through legitimate services, streaming platforms, or purchasing physical copies. It's also important to note that the laws regarding copyright and digital music are constantly evolving. What might be legal in one country could be illegal in another. It's always a good idea to research the specific laws in your area and stay informed about any changes. Furthermore, the legality can also be influenced by the intended use of the downloaded music. Downloading music for personal use might be viewed differently than downloading music for commercial purposes, like creating content. Safe Alternatives to Zona Lagu for Free Music Downloads

Don't worry, guys! There are some safe and legal alternatives to Zona Lagu where you can get your music fix without the risks. Let's explore some of them:

  • Streaming Services with Free Tiers: Many popular streaming services, like Spotify and YouTube Music, offer free tiers. With these free options, you can listen to a vast library of music. While there may be some limitations, like ads and the inability to download songs for offline listening, it's a great way to access music legally. It's a fantastic option for discovering new artists and genres. It's also a great way to create your playlists. The legal and ethical aspect makes this option a preferred choice.

  • Free Music Archives: Websites like the Internet Archive offer a treasure trove of free music, including public domain recordings and music released under Creative Commons licenses. This is a brilliant option as these sites make music available to the public for free. The music on these sites is often available for download, and you can listen to it without any legal concerns. It's a great way to discover forgotten gems and explore experimental music that's hard to find elsewhere. This helps you to discover new talents from the community.

  • SoundCloud and Bandcamp: Many independent artists and labels use platforms like SoundCloud and Bandcamp to share their music. You can often find free downloads or the option to stream music for free. Some artists allow you to download their music for free. This is a fantastic way to support emerging artists and discover music that might not be available on mainstream platforms. Support independent artists with their amazing music.

  • Free Music from Artists' Websites: Some artists offer free downloads of their music directly from their websites. This is a win-win situation; you get free music, and the artists get more exposure. Check your favorite artist's official website, and look for free music downloads. This will provide you with high-quality and safe music.

  • Public Domain Music: Music that has passed into the public domain is another excellent option. This is music where the copyright has expired, or the copyright holder has explicitly waived their rights. You can find many classical music recordings and other works in the public domain. This ensures that you're downloading music legally and safely.

Tips for Safe and Legal Music Downloads

Okay, here are some essential tips to keep you safe when you're downloading music, whether you're using legal sources or exploring other options:

  • Use a Reliable Antivirus Software: Always have up-to-date antivirus software installed on all your devices. Scan every file you download before opening it to make sure it's free from viruses and other malware. Regularly update your antivirus software to ensure it can detect the latest threats. Your antivirus software is your first line of defense against malicious software. Stay ahead of the curve with good anti-virus software.

  • Be Wary of Suspicious Websites: Avoid downloading music from websites that seem shady or untrustworthy. Look for websites with a good reputation and secure connections (HTTPS). Avoid clicking on pop-up ads or any links that seem suspicious. Trust your instincts, and if something feels off, it's best to avoid it.

  • Verify File Extensions: Make sure the file extensions of the downloaded files are legitimate (e.g., .mp3, .wav). Be cautious of any files with unusual extensions, as they might be malicious. Do not download files that you don't recognize.

  • Read Reviews and Check for Complaints: Before downloading from a new website, search for reviews and check for any complaints. See what other users have to say about their experience with the website. This can give you valuable insights into the website's reliability and safety. Listen to other people's experience.

  • Respect Copyright Laws: Always respect copyright laws and the rights of artists. Support artists by purchasing music through legal channels whenever possible. Avoid downloading copyrighted music without permission. Make sure to download music from authorized sources only.

  • Educate Yourself: Keep yourself informed about copyright laws and the latest trends in music downloading. Stay up-to-date with any changes in the legal landscape. The more you know, the better equipped you'll be to make informed decisions.

  • Use a VPN: Consider using a Virtual Private Network (VPN) when downloading music. A VPN can help protect your online privacy by encrypting your internet traffic and masking your IP address. This adds an extra layer of security and can help protect your personal information.
